highlights and features


Speech- With Read & Write text can be read back by each word, sentence, paragraph, selected text or spoken as the User types. Read & Write is compatible with Microsoft SAPI 4 and 5 speech technology and comes with a choice of 34 different voices including British and American accents. The voices can be adjusted to suit the individual requirements of the User by altering the pitch, speed, volume and/or word pause.

Spell Checking- Read & Write incorporates a fast advanced spellchecker specifically designed to solve the most complex of phonetic errors. The spellchecker can be customized to suit individual needs and provides audible definitions of alternative suggestions to help you choose the correct one.

Homophones Support- Read&Write has an improved homophone database with the option to select from basic or advanced homophone suggestions, further enhancing the suggestions relevance to the User.

Word Prediction - The Read & Write word predictor learns the Users style of writing and predicts the word they want to use next. It also incorporates a prediction database based on a 100 million-word corpus. As the User types, a list of suggestions will appear in the Prediction Panel.

Web Highlighting- The new Web highlighting feature of Read&Write allows the User to experience dual color highlighting with audible feedback in HTML documents. This is of particular use for Users with literacy difficulties when accessing information online and also aids the Users concentration and comprehension.

Dictionary- 180,000 words are provided with alternative suggestions in the Read&Write dictionary, thus developing the User’s creative writing skills.

Simple Calculator- Read&Write has an easy to use Simple Calculator. Not only does this provide the most common functions associated with a Simple Calculator but it also provides an audit trail so that each User can see their calculations as they go.

Word Wizard- Word wizard assists in developing creative sentences by offering solutions for vocabulary. When you are searching for the word you want to use Word Wizard takes you though a simple step by step process till you find the word you are looking for..

Teachers' Toolkit- An Educator can control which features of Read & Write a student has access to.
